Assume the distance between the resource (r ) and the market (m) is 10 miles. a firm’s procurement cost is given by pc=0.5x2 , where x is the distance from the resource measured in miles. the firm’s distribution cost is given by dc=100-0.5x. again, x is the distance from the resource. (a) what is the total freight cost at each milestone (i. e., x=0, 1, 2, 3, …10). where should the firm locate? (b) how does your answer to all parts under (a) change if the marginal procurement cost were equal to zero?
